Original Toronto Star caption: Hard times hit St. Hilda's Church, Rector Resigns. Owing to the severity with which the depression has hit the congregation of St. Hilda's Anglican church, Fairbank, York township, affairs of the church have according to members of the finance committee reached a crisis. On Sunday morning Rev. H. R. Yonge, the rector, announced his resignation, amid expressions of regret from the members...St. Hilda's church (5), has grown greatly under the leadership of Mr. Young, who is well-known for his work in aid of the needy of York township.
